Step 1: Understand the Locations of Injury from Head to Toe
- (D) Contusion on cranium — This is an injury to the head (cranium), which is the topmost part of the body.
- (C) Humerus Dislocation — The humerus is the upper arm bone, hence this injury is located at the shoulder level.
- (B) Groin muscle pull — The groin is located between the abdomen and thigh, closer to the pelvis.
- (A) Tibial Sprain — The tibia is one of the bones in the lower leg (shin area), which is near the feet.
Step 2: Arranging from Top (Head) to Bottom (Toes)
So, the logical top-to-bottom order is:
(D) Cranium → (C) Shoulder → (B) Groin → (A) Tibia
Step 3: Final Answer
Therefore, the correct arrangement is (D), (C), (B), (A).
